Precision Engineering: A Deep Dive into the Design Features of Male Seal Interlock Fittings

In the difficult world of hydraulic system, in which performance and reliability are paramount, the layout of components plays a pivotal role. Male Seal Interlock Fittings, frequently ignored of their subtlety, stand as exemplars of precision engineering. 
At the core of Male Seal Interlock Fittings is a meticulous attention to detail in their creation. These fittings are engineered with precision to achieve a snug match, making sure a steady and leak-free connection among hydraulic components. The layout normally includes threads and a locking mechanism that, while engaged, creates a strong seal, stopping any fluid leakage below excessive pressures. The threading itself is a feat of precision engineering, meticulously calculated to facilitate easy meeting at the same time as ensuring the integrity of the connection.
One of the standout capabilities of these fittings lies in their versatility. Engineers cautiously consider the range of applications those fittings may stumble upon, main to a layout that incorporates numerous hydraulic systems. Whether utilized in heavy machinery, business system, or automobile structures, Male Seal Interlock Fittings are engineered to satisfy the diverse needs of hydraulic connections. This adaptability extends to their compatibility with distinct sorts of hydraulic hoses, adding to the ability of their implementation.
Durability is a non-negotiable component of hydraulic components, and Male Seal Interlock Fittings are not any exception. The substances used of their construction are chosen with longevity in mind. Often made from excessive-grade stainless-steel or other corrosion-resistant alloys, these fittings showcase resilience against the cruel conditions frequent in lots of commercial environments. This no longer simplest enhances their lifespan however also ensures consistent performance over prolonged intervals, contributing to the overall reliability of the hydraulic machine.
